US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"outside its designed application"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a situation where something is being used in a way that was not intended or specified by its design. Example: "Using the software for tasks it was not built for can lead to errors, as it operates outside its designed application."

FAQs

What does "outside its designed application" mean?

It means using something in a way that the designers did not originally intend or specify.

Is it always bad to use something "outside its designed application"?

Not necessarily. Sometimes, using something in a way it wasn't designed for can lead to innovation or unexpected benefits. However, it can also lead to problems or failures if the design isn't suited for the new use case.

What are some risks of using something "outside its designed application"?

Risks can include reduced performance, increased risk of damage or failure, and potential safety hazards. It's important to carefully consider the implications before using something in a way it wasn't designed for.
